Salaam, my name is Dena Makarious.
I was born in Egypt and spent the first eight years of my life living in Cairo until my family, and I moved to Ōtautahi, Aoteoroa, where I have spent most
of my life.
I am a registered Intern Psychologist, currently in the final year of my Postgraduate Diploma in Clinical Psychology at the University of Canterbury. I have completed my master's thesis, which focused on examining the link between PTSD, memory, dissociation, and anxiety.
I am passionate about mental health and working with people and I feel honoured to be in a position where I can listen to people share their stories and understand what shapes their identities.
I am blessed to be part of such a passionate and hardworking team that is embedded within a beautiful Kaupapa Māori service.
